The Current Landscape of Urban Mobility in Nigeria

Urban mobility in Nigeria presents unique challenges. According to a report by the World Bank, cities are often characterized by inadequate public transport, heavy reliance on informal transport systems, and congested roadways. With a population of over 200 million, the need for innovative solutions is more pressing than ever.

 Ride-Hailing Services

One of the most notable disruptions in Nigeria’s transportation sector is the emergence of ride-hailing services. Companies like Uber and Bolt have revolutionized how people navigate the urban landscape. These platforms provide quick, convenient, and relatively affordable transport options directly from users’ smartphones.

In a bustling city like Lagos, where traditional transportation options may be unreliable, ride-hailing services have become a lifeline. Not only do they reduce the need for personal vehicles, but they also provide users with real-time tracking, fare estimation, and a host of payment options. This technology fosters a culture of safety and convenience, which is especially appealing to many commuters.

BRT and Bus Services

Despite the convenience of ride-hailing, many people still rely on more traditional forms of public transport. To meet this demand, Nigeria has been enhancing its public bus systems, such as the Bus Rapid Transit (BRT) in Lagos. The Lagos BRT system aims to offer safe, reliable, and affordable transportation for thousands of commuters daily. Equipped with dedicated bus lanes, the BRT helps reduce congestion, while also providing a structured timetable for commuters—elements that enhance overall user experience.

Electric Vehicles (EVs)

The global shift toward environmentally friendly transportation also reaches Nigeria, as electric vehicles (EVs) begin to gain traction. With growing concerns about air pollution and the effects of climate change, Nigerians are exploring the potential of EVs as a greener alternative. Companies like Stallion Group have committed to expanding EV infrastructure in the country.

Furthermore, the Nigeria Electric Vehicle Initiative (NEVI) aims to stimulate a robust EV market through incentives and partnerships. The installation of charging stations and the introduction of government policies can yield significant advancements in reducing vehicular emissions.

 Smart Traffic Management Systems

Innovative technologies are not limited to new vehicles; they also include enhancing existing infrastructures, such as traffic management systems. Smart traffic management utilizes real-time data to optimize traffic flow, predict congestion points, and reduce travel times. For example, platforms using IoT (Internet of Things) sensors can analyze traffic conditions and adjust traffic light timing to enhance mobility.

Cities like Lagos are already exploring these smart solutions, significantly improving the urban commuter experience. With efficient traffic management, cities can alleviate congestion and enhance overall urban mobility.

 Metro and Railway Systems

Efforts to develop railway systems are re-emerging in Nigeria with possibilities of alleviating traffic congestion in hyper-urban regions. Projects like The Lagos Railway Project are major initiatives aimed at enhancing urban mobility. The government has ambitious plans to expand the railway network, providing safe, reliable, and efficient transit options that can accommodate larger populations.

Railway systems allow for swift travel across the city, preserving the environment by reducing carbon emissions associated with road transport—another step towards sustainable urban mobility.

 Micro-mobility Solutions

Micro-mobility is emerging as a popular choice for short-distance travel. Innovations such as e-scooters, bicycles, and bike-sharing programs are gaining traction among urban dwellers. For instance, companies like Gokada and Max.ng offer bike services that navigate through traffic efficiently.

These options are particularly appealing in congested cities where conventional vehicles may struggle. Micro-mobility solutions promote versatility, allowing users to cover short distances quickly and affordably, while also helping to reduce congestion and pollution.

 Integration of Mobility-as-a-Service (MaaS)

The concept of Mobility-as-a-Service (MaaS) combines various transport options into a single accessible service, allowing users to plan and pay for their journeys through one platform. Nigeria’s advancing tech infrastructure indicates that we might soon see the integration of this concept into urban mobility solutions, further enhancing user convenience.
